How to Convert Notepad Text to JSON Format?
Converting Notepad text to JSON format requires understanding the structure of JSON and using appropriate tools or programming languages. Notepad text files are typically plain text, lacking the structured data representation inherent in JSON. Therefore, the conversion process involves transforming the unstructured Notepad data into a structured JSON format. This transformation depends heavily on the format of your Notepad text.
Let's assume your Notepad text contains data that needs to be organized into a JSON object or array. For instance, consider this Notepad text:
<code>Name: John Doe
Age: 30
City: New York</code>
Copy after login
To convert this to JSON, you need to define a structure. A simple JSON representation could be:
{
"Name": "John Doe",
"Age": 30,
"City": "New York"
}
Copy after login
This requires manual intervention. You'll need to:
-
Identify the data elements: Determine the key-value pairs you want to include in your JSON object.
-
Structure the data: Organize the data into a proper JSON structure, ensuring correct syntax (e.g., using double quotes for keys and values, proper comma separation, etc.).
-
Use a text editor or IDE: A text editor with syntax highlighting for JSON (like VS Code, Sublime Text, Atom) will greatly assist in ensuring correct JSON formatting and detecting errors.
You can perform this conversion manually by copying the formatted JSON into a new file and saving it with a .json
extension.
Can I Use a Shortcut to Convert Notepad Text to JSON?
There's no single "shortcut" button or built-in function to directly convert Notepad text to JSON. The process intrinsically requires understanding the data and structuring it according to JSON rules. However, you can streamline the process using several approaches:
-
Using scripting languages (Python, JavaScript, etc.): If your Notepad data has a consistent pattern, you can write a short script to automate the conversion. These scripts can parse the Notepad text, extract relevant data, and construct the JSON structure programmatically. This is significantly faster than manual conversion for large datasets with predictable formats.
-
Using online JSON converters (with limitations): Some online tools claim to convert text to JSON, but they often require your data to follow specific formats. They might be suitable for simple cases but may not handle complex or irregularly formatted Notepad text effectively. These tools usually require you to manually define the structure, making them less of a "shortcut" and more of a structured manual process.
What Are the Best Tools or Methods for Converting Notepad Files to JSON?
The "best" tool or method depends on your data's complexity and your technical skills. Here are some options:
-
Manual Conversion (for small, simple datasets): For small amounts of data with a clear structure, manual conversion using a text editor is the simplest approach.
-
Scripting Languages (Python, JavaScript, etc.): For larger datasets or datasets with complex structures, scripting languages offer powerful tools for parsing and transforming text into JSON. Python's
json
library, for instance, is very efficient.
-
Spreadsheet Software (Excel, Google Sheets): If your Notepad data is tabular, you can import it into a spreadsheet, organize it, and then export it as a JSON file. This approach is useful when dealing with data that can be easily represented in a table format.
-
Online JSON Converters (for simple cases): While limited in handling complex data, online converters can be useful for quick conversions of simple, well-structured text. However, always check the tool's capabilities and limitations before using it.
-
Specialized Data Transformation Tools: For complex data transformation needs, professional-grade ETL (Extract, Transform, Load) tools might be necessary. These tools offer advanced features for data manipulation and cleaning.
Choosing the right method depends on your data's nature and your comfort level with programming or using specialized software. For simple cases, manual conversion or a spreadsheet might suffice. For more complex situations, scripting or dedicated data transformation tools are better choices.
The above is the detailed content of How to convert notepad to json notepad to json shortcut key. For more information, please follow other related articles on the PHP Chinese website!